> Jorway Model 411 CAMAC? Looks like a Massbus cable going into it.
CAMAC = Computer Assisted Measurement And Control (or something similar).
It's a bust standard used particulalry for particle physics instrumentation.
The unit you have is probably a controller. The cable is unlikely to be
Massbus, it might well be the Unibus signals, though. You put that module
at one end of a CAMAC crate (the backplane is not just pin-pin wired,
BTW), and put other CAMAC modules in the remaining slots.
> ACT quad board that appears to be 4 serial ports; it has 4x40-pin
> Bergs that sound link a Quadralink (?) that was mentioned recently on
> the list.
FWIW, the single DEC serial cards (DL11) for Unibus machines used 40 pin
Bergs for the interface cable connector. My first guess, if this is a
quad serial card, is that the connectors on that board have the same pinout.
